L-com, Inc. OM5 50/125 Multimode Fiber Cable, Dual SC / Dual LC, 15.0m with OFNR Zipcord Jacket FODSC-LCOM5-15

Description
These OM5, 50/125 Multimode laser optimized fiber optic cables are constructed from the highest quality silica and are 100% factory tested. Typically, 100 Gigabit applications are run on 9/125 Singlemode fibers, which require costly laser transceivers. By utilizing these fiber optic cables, users are able to implement high speed, low cost Multimode transceivers or VCSEL's (Vertical Cavity Surface Emitting Lasers). The OM5 fiber is optimized for SWDM (short wavelength division multiplexing) resulting in greater overall system cost savings. Custom lengths, connector combinations and polishes are available.
